Abstract

This work's aim is to show how nihilism, properly understood, does not undermine the possibility of its own overcoming. Central to the success of this task is to show how our body, in Nietzsche's work, plays a fundamental role in conceiving an alternative, non-metaphysical ground for meaning. This new conception characterizes perspectivism in such a way that it enables the revaluation of life-negating values, necessary to overcome nihilism.
